Course Advisor (Former Employee) - Warrington, Cheshire - 5 March 2020
The company went into administration on 27.2.20 and left hundreds of employees out in the cold! The day before pay day we were told that the we had lost our Jobs and that we would not get paid
The sales we had done in Feb still existed! This was the bigges insult I jabd ever had in my 19 year working lifehad

Tele Agent (Former Employee) - Warrington, Cheshire - 3 March 2020
Worked for this company for 6 months, my colleagues worked there for 17+ years. On 27/02/2020 every staff member from 5 offices received a text for a team meeting after the shift, during that meeting we was told the pay we were expecting to get the following day was not happening as they are in administration and 300+ employees made redundant without any warning or any pay.
